First one with a Barnett Crossbow. I was a skeptic but I injured my hand at work and if it wasn't for the Xbow I would not have an archery season this year. It did an excellant job and I couldn't have been happier. 20 yard pass thru with the Grimm Reaper expandable head. 6pt dressed 160 lbs
